    Question shoulders...help

    ok i do each muscle 1x a week and my shoulders never get sore or anything i feel like i don't work them hard enough..heres what i do

    military press 4x6-8
    lateral raises 3x8-10

    only 7sets...should i do more or change the exercises?

    Try using some different movements and different set/rep parameters. Of course, this is if your goal is to get sore. If your goal is to get stronger or bigger, then just make sure you're accomplishing those goals and don't worry about getting sore.
